Filename: draft-zhu-core-groupauth Revision: 01 Title: Group Authentication Creation date: 2013-09-29 Group: Individual Submission Number of pages: 12 URL: http://www.ietf.org/internet-drafts/draft-zhu-core-groupauth-01.txt Status: http://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-zhu-core-groupauth Htmlized: http://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-zhu-core-groupauth-01 Diff: http://www.ietf.org/rfcdiff?url2=draft-zhu-core-groupauth-01 Abstract: The group communication is designed for the communication of Internet of Things. A threat is identified in [I-D.ietf-core-groupcomm] that current DTLS based approach is unicast oriented and there is no supporting on group authentication feature. Unicast oriented authentication will causing serious burden when a large number of terminal nodes will be involved inevitably. In another aspect, some terminals will own the same characteristics, such as owning same features, in the same place, working in the same time, etc. With this mechanism, all terminals can be authenticated together with little signaling and calculation at the same time. It will reduce the network burden and save time. This draft describes the security of group authentication and an group authentication implementation method for the Internet of things.
